I recently upgrade from Ubuntu 18.04 to 20.04 and then to 22.04. At least when going from 20.04 to 22.04 I got a prompt asking if I wanted to install the latest kernel, and I said yes (I can't remember what exactly happened when going from 18.04 to 22.04, to be perfectly honest).
The upgrades seemed to complete successfully, and I rebooted after each. However, it looks like the system is still using the old kernel despite the new old having been installed (as far as I can tell, anyway). Is there somewhere I have to specify what Kernel to use?
Here is some potentially relevant output:
$ lsb_release -a
No LSB modules are available.
Distributor ID: Ubuntu
Description: Ubuntu 22.04.1 LTS
Release: 22.04
Codename: jammy
$ uname -a
Linux r13-003 4.15.0-122-lowlatency #124-Ubuntu SMP PREEMPT Thu Oct 15 13:40:54 UTC 2020 x86_64 x86_64 x86_64 GNU/Linux

I would like to run 5.15, which seems to be installed, but as you can see I'm currently on 4.15
